Dollar General Seeks Variance to Build Store on Route 37

The Dollar General chain of discount stores is seeking permission from the township’s zoning board to build a new store on Route 37 East between Coolidge and Gouveneur avenues.

The project requires a variance because one of the plots that will be taken up by the new store is located at 317 Buermann Avenue, which is located in a residential zone. The front-facing portion of the store will be at 2017 Route 37 East, which is located in the highway business zone.



The township’s Board of Adjustment will hear Dollar General’s application at its Dec. 12 meeting. The developer of the store, Toms River DG, LLC, is asking for permission to build an approximately 7,500 square foot retail store and associated parking lot, plus drainage improvements, lighting and landscaping. The project requires a use variance – the most difficult type to obtain under the law – because of the residential zoning of a portion of the plot of land on which the store may be built.

The Dec. 12 meeting will only deal with the use variance. According to planning documents, if approval is granted, the company will come back to the board to present a final site plan and apply for any additional minor variances or design waivers that are needed.

The meeting will be held at 6:30 p.m. in the L. Manuel Hirshblond Meeting Room within the Township of Toms River Municipal Building, located at 33 Washington Street.
